Job description

J.P. Morgan Asset Management, with assets under management of $1.7 trillion (as of December 31, 2014), is a global leader in investment management. J.P. Morgan Asset Management's clients include institutions, retail investors and high-net worth individuals in every major market throughout the world. J.P. Morgan Asset Management offers global investment management in equities, fixed income, real estate, hedge funds, private equity and liquidity.

Investment Management Americas ("IMA") is a division of J.P. Morgan Asset Management. IMA US Funds Platform Management is responsible for business management and oversight for J.P. Morgan pooled vehicles including mutual funds, collective investment funds and hedge funds (collectively referred to as "Funds"). IMA US Funds Platform Management is comprised of the following functional areas: Funds Treasury, Governance and Board Management, Taxation, Vendor Management, Risk & Controls, Product Development, and Product Implementation.

Job Description:

As a Project Analyst, the individual will be responsible for assisting with and in some cases directly managing requests for changes impacting the JPMorgan Funds. These include but are not limited to Portfolio Management additions/removals, share class launches, transitions in-kind, and requests for new investments. The individual will be responsible for working with cross-functional teams across JPMorgan Chase and also at the Fund's third party service providers. The Project Analyst will work closely with the rest of the Product Implementation team and at times partner with them on the effective management and execution of complex Fund launches and other initiatives impacting the Funds including Regulatory and business driven changes.

The role mandates that the individual have strong written and verbal communication skills, previous Project Management experience, good working knowledge of the Funds industry, and thrive in a team environment yet also demonstrate abilities as an individual contributor.
